Safety
Bunk beds are an excellent way to save space in small spaces However, they can risky if not planned carefully. Children's injuries resulting from bunk beds are increasing however, these injuries are usually preventable. The majority of these injuries are caused by the way children misuse and abuse the bunk bed, and not a structural problem. If you follow a few basic rules, you can help keep your children safe as they sleep in their loft bed. beds with desks.
The most important rule is that children younger than the age of six should never sleep on the top bunk. This is because children that are young lack the maturity to safely walk an up-staircase or ladder to their sleeping area. Children at this age should be sleeping in a single loft bunk bed or double bed that is at ground level.
It is also necessary to put guard rails on both sides of top bunk. They should be at least 5 inches higher than the mattress's top (including the mattress pad and bedding), to prevent accidents. The guardrails must also be free of any gaps that could allow a person get trapped. Additionally any objects hanging from the rails should be removed to prevent strangulation.
If you're concerned about your child climbing up to their loft bed, think about installing a ladder with a handrail. Place the ladder in the corner of the room to avoid two possible sides from which the person could fall. It is also important to ensure that the ladder is safe and regularly check it to ensure its safety.
A loft safety net is a great option for safety. Online sellers sell these nets, which are designed to fit over loft bunk single bed beds that are double in size. These nets are extremely sturdy and have the size of a mesh that is small enough to stop children from climbing over the edges of their bunk beds.
